Wayfair (NYSE:W – Get Free Report) was downgraded by research analysts at Wall Street Zen from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report issued to clients and investors on Saturday.
Several other research firms have also commented on W. Cowen reissued a “hold” rating on shares of Wayfair in a report on Wednesday, October 29th. Royal Bank Of Canada increased their price target on shares of Wayfair from $51.00 to $86.00 and gave the stock a “sector perform” rating in a research report on Thursday, October 30th. Raymond James Financial lifted their price objective on shares of Wayfair from $90.00 to $130.00 and gave the company a “strong-bu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, October 29th. Citigroup boosted their price target on Wayfair from $105.00 to $135.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Wednesday, October 29th. Finally, Barclays upped their price objective on Wayfair from $70.00 to $104.00 and gave the stock a “positive” rating in a research report on Wednesday, October 29th. Two investment anal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, eighteen have issued a Buy rating, ten have issued a Hold rating and two have given a Sell r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at, the stock curr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us target price of $105.29.

Wayfair Stock Performance
Wayfair (NYSE:W –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 28th. The company reported $0.70 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.44 by $0.26. The company had revenue of $3.12 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.01 billion.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 8.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$0.22 EPS. Research analysts predict that Wayfair will post -2.54 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Insider Buying and Selling at Wayfair
In related news, CEO Niraj Shah sold 150,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Monday, November 24th. The stock was sold at an average price of $105.91, for a total transaction of $15,886,500.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er directly owned 729,137 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$77,222,899.67. This trade represents a 17.06%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this hyperlink. Also, insider Steven Conine sold 150,000 shares of Wayfair stock in a transaction dated Monday, November 24th. The stock was sold at an average price of $105.92, for a total value of $15,888,000.00. Following the transaction, the insider directly owned 729,073 shares in the company, valued at $77,223,412.16. The trade was a 17.06%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. Insiders have sold 955,959 shares of company stock valued at $88,260,274 in the last ninety days. Insiders own 21.91% of the company’s stock.

Wayfair Company Profile
Wayfair Inc provides e-commerce business in the United States and internationally. The company offers approximately thirty million products for the home sector. It offers online selections of furniture, décor, housewares, and home improvement products through its sites consisting of Wayfair, Joss & Main, AllModern, Birch Lane, Perigold, and Wayfair Professional.
